i lost my RC3 while on a search and rescue mission. we had a terrible winter storm blow in with zero visibility and winds over 100km/hr. my brother got stranded in the storm and me and another guy on the fire dept went to rescue him. to make a long story short we were out for 4.5 hrs had 3 trucks stuck and had to get a tractor to get us out.drifts covered the trucks in a matter of minutes. somewhere in the process i lost my RC3,im glad everyone was ok but im pretty bummed out to lose my daily sidekick in life. im in the middle of a career change so money is a little tight, so i made my own temporary replacement. roughly the same size but with cocobolo handles. what do you think?its the bottom one

for those who front pocket w/boot clip do this.......
Take a piece of paracord your color choice....on one end crimp on Alligator clip your size choice....then tie other end of paracord to ESEE sheath. turn Front pocket inside out ,using alligator clip to grasp pants pocket....tuck pocket back in pants...sheath stay in pocket.... back up plan to those who use boot clip option...
